The purpose of the Leadership Committee is to find new leaders, identity existing leaders, and enhance knowledge to better equip these women to serve with the confidence and skills to better the mission of the American Legion Auxiliary.

The concept of Leadership is believable and achievable for every member – not just those who are currently serving in leadership positions. The key to good Leadership is to build confidence in those you lead, treat all members with dignity and respect, and to be a good listener. No matter the experience, education, or technical skills, most anyone can be trained to be a leader if they are willing to make a commitment, devote their time and energy to listen, learn, and communicate.
